NEW YORK CITY (WABC) -- A mass shooting in manhattan last Monday night, but this was not your typical gun insanity.

Instead, the killer drove a semi-automatic rifle all the way from Las Vegas to 345 Park Avenue in Midtown.

He went into the high-rise building and started shooting, killing 4 people and wounding a fifth before turning the weapon on himself.

Manhattan joins the growing and epidemic list of u.s. communities hit with mass shootings.

New York Governor Kathy Hochul joins us to talk about the mass shooting, gun laws, and something many people may not know - the stunning number of New Yorkers who will be losing their health insurance under President Trump's new bill.
